ZIP Code 78538 (Hidalgo County, Texas) is home to about 10,740 residents. At $38,904, its median household income sits below Hidalgo County's $52,281.

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 78538's population declined 3.6% from 11,137 to 10,740, while its median gross rent rose 22.3% from $479 to $586.

The median resident is 34.2 years old. The largest age group is 5 to 17, 23.2% of residents.
